Skip to content

Commit 5124bc3

Browse files
committed
Fix Jenkins pipeline structure
1 parent 2f89397 commit 5124bc3

File tree

1 file changed

+16
-11
lines changed

1 file changed

+16
-11
lines changed

Jenkinsfile

Lines changed: 16 additions &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-1,13 +1,18 @@
1-
stage('Unit Tests') {
2-
steps {
3-
sh 'composer install'
4-
sh 'php vendor/bin/phpunit --coverage-openclover ./clover.xml'
5-
clover(
6-
cloverReportDir: 'build/logs',
7-
cloverReportFileName: 'clover.xml',
8-
healthyTarget: [methodCoverage: 70, conditionalCoverage: 80, statementCoverage: 80],
9-
unhealthyTarget: [methodCoverage: 50, conditionalCoverage: 50, statementCoverage: 50],
10-
failingTarget: [methodCoverage: 0, conditionalCoverage: 0, statementCoverage: 0]
11-
)
1+
pipeline {
2+
agent any
3+
stages {
4+
stage('Unit Tests') {
5+
steps {
6+
sh 'composer install'
7+
sh 'php vendor/bin/phpunit --coverage-openclover ./clover.xml'
8+
clover(
9+
cloverReportDir: 'build/logs',
10+
cloverReportFileName: 'clover.xml',
11+
healthyTarget: [methodCoverage: 70, conditionalCoverage: 80, statementCoverage: 80],
12+
unhealthyTarget: [methodCoverage: 50, conditionalCoverage: 50, statementCoverage: 50],
13+
failingTarget: [methodCoverage: 0, conditionalCoverage: 0, statementCoverage: 0]
14+
)
15+
}
16+
}
1217
}
1318
}

0 commit comments

Comments
 (0)